Backhoe trenching services involve the use of a backhoe, a versatile piece of heavy equipment equipped with a digging bucket on the end of a two-part articulated arm. These services are typically employed to excavate narrow, deep trenches in various types of soil and terrain. The process allows for precise digging, making it suitable for laying underground utilities such as water, sewer, or electrical lines, as well as for drainage systems or irrigation setups. The equipment's ability to operate in confined spaces and its efficiency in moving large amounts of soil make backhoe trenching a practical choice for many excavation projects.

Cost Range for Backhoe Trenching - Typical expenses for backhoe trenching services vary between $1,000 and $4,500, depending on project size and soil conditions. For example, a small residential trenching job may cost around $1,200, while larger commercial projects could reach $4,000 or more.

Factors Influencing Pricing - Costs are influenced by trench length, depth, and terrain difficulty. Trenching a 50-foot long, 3-foot deep trench might cost approximately $1,500, whereas extending to 200 feet or deeper excavation increases the price accordingly.

Average Cost per Foot - Many contractors charge between $4 and $12 per linear foot for trenching services. For instance, a 100-foot trench could range from $400 to $1,200, depending on complexity and accessibility.

Additional Expenses - Extra costs may include site preparation, debris removal, and restoration work, which can add several hundred dollars to the total. Contact local pros to get estimates based on specific project requirements.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is backhoe trenching used for? Backhoe trenching is commonly used for installing underground utilities, drainage systems, and irrigation lines, as well as for landscaping and foundation work.

How deep can a backhoe trench? The depth of a backhoe trench typically ranges up to 10-12 feet, depending on the equipment and project requirements.

What factors influence the cost of backhoe trenching services? Costs can vary based on trench length, depth, soil conditions, and accessibility of the site.

How long does backhoe trenching usually take? The duration depends on the size and complexity of the project but generally ranges from a few hours to a couple of days.

How should I prepare my property for backhoe trenching? Clearing the work area of obstacles and ensuring access for equipment can help facilitate a smooth trenching process.
